Boozy vanilla nose. Luscious dark chocolate edging on coffee. The malty body is sweet, thick and chewy. Hints of molasses, some dark fruit, maybe fig. It all settles in this tantalizing boozy body, that sets it all off! At 17.3%, it’s smooth and stunning!
